Its an import mirror. From what I know its an ADR requirment to have a normal mirror on the drivers side and a convex on the passenger side after a certain year model. All import cars that have convex on the drivers side have to have them removed for ADR's. So all import cars have new tyres, new drivers side mirrors, some lights disconected in the rear garnish of a skyline, and it just keeps going.
